1

我有一个页面可以在 sharepoint 中作为弹出窗口。现在我可以使用这个 javascript 来识别它是否是一个弹出窗口 if ( window.location.search.match("[?&]IsDlg=1")) 但我无法弄清楚如何插入一些基于 css如果这个条件为真。

我想的一种方法是在页面中有一个标签,然后使用后面的代码来识别条件并插入 css,但我也想通过 javascript 检查这是否可能。有人可以指导我。

我想我可以像这样用 jQuery 做一些事情

$('<style type="text/css">#foo { background: #000; } </style>').appendTo("head");

谢谢

4

1 回答 1

1

不确定我是否理解您的问题,也许您可​​以显示一些代码?使用 jQuery,您可以像这样设置 css:

$('.my-div').css('display','block');

或者您可以只编写 css 并将其放入样式表中,然后在元素上设置类,如下所示:

$('.my-div').addClass('yellow-border');
于 2012-12-05T20:22:10.633 回答